What you probably want to do is *integrate with* MobileFrontend, but keep
your code within WikiBase extension and friends.
There's provisions now for specifying desktop or mobile targets separately
in ResourceLoader, which will let you load either the same or different CSS
and JS for mobile views. You could also format your special pages
differently, but I recommend doing the differences in CSS and JS if you
can, to keep things clean.
But you could also detect that mobile view is in use and change the
formatting of a Special: page directly, for instance.
